Connected Automation Data Flow

Understanding the 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 requires viewing it not as a standalone drive, but as an active participant in a layered industrial data network. At the field level, sensors — including encoders, temperature transmitters, and proximity switches — feed real-time process signals into the drive’s analog and digital I/O terminals. The drive processes these signals to execute precise speed and torque control, while simultaneously packaging operational data — output frequency, motor current, DC bus voltage, fault codes — into Profibus-DP data frames for upstream transmission.

These data frames travel across the Profibus-DP backbone to a Siemens S7-300 or S7-1500 PLC, where the controller executes the automation logic — adjusting setpoints, triggering interlocks, and coordinating multi-axis motion sequences. The PLC communicates upstream via Industrial Ethernet (PROFINET) to a Siemens SIMATIC HMI panel, where operators monitor drive status, trend historical data, and acknowledge alarms in real time.

For sites running USS protocol topologies, the 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 connects via RS-485 to a Siemens CM 1241 RS-485 communication module or compatible serial gateway, enabling parameter access and control from a SIMATIC S7-1200 PLC. This configuration is particularly common in retrofit projects where legacy serial networks are being extended rather than replaced.

At the SCADA layer, a Siemens SIMATIC WinCC or third-party SCADA platform — connected via OPC-UA or PROFINET — aggregates drive data from multiple 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 units across the production floor. Alongside these drives, Siemens ET 200SP remote I/O modules extend the control network to distributed field cabinets, while SCALANCE X-series industrial Ethernet switches provide the managed network infrastructure that ensures deterministic, low-jitter data delivery across the plant.

In energy-intensive applications such as HVAC, water treatment, or compressor control, the 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 works in parallel with Siemens SENTRON PAC energy meters to provide a complete picture of drive-level energy consumption, feeding data into MES and ERP systems for production cost analysis. Edge computing gateways — such as the Siemens SIMATIC IPC127E — can further pre-process drive telemetry locally before forwarding aggregated datasets to cloud-based analytics platforms, enabling predictive maintenance and anomaly detection without saturating the plant network.

Solving Data Isolation in Industrial Sites

One of the most persistent challenges in industrial automation is the fragmentation of communication protocols across generations of equipment. A plant may simultaneously operate Profibus-DP legacy networks alongside newer PROFINET segments, with older drives communicating via USS serial links and newer controllers expecting Ethernet-based data. The result is data isolation — critical operational information trapped within individual devices, invisible to the broader control and monitoring infrastructure.

The 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 directly addresses this challenge. Its native Profibus-DP interface allows it to participate as a standard DP slave on existing Profibus networks without requiring additional gateway hardware, reducing integration complexity and latency. For sites transitioning to PROFINET, the drive’s USS interface provides a bridge path via serial-to-Ethernet converters, preserving the investment in existing cabling infrastructure while enabling data visibility at the SCADA level.

Remote monitoring and diagnostics are equally critical. Through Profibus-DP cyclic communication, the drive continuously reports fault codes, warning states, and operational parameters to the PLC and SCADA system. Maintenance teams can identify developing faults — bearing wear, overtemperature conditions, input phase loss — before they cause unplanned downtime, shifting from reactive to predictive maintenance strategies. Remote parameter adjustment via the network eliminates the need for on-site technician visits for routine setpoint changes, reducing operational costs in geographically distributed facilities.

Production line transparency is another key benefit. With the 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 integrated into the plant network, production managers gain real-time visibility into drive performance across every conveyor, pump, fan, and compressor on the floor. OEE (Overall Equipment Effectiveness) calculations become data-driven rather than estimated, and system expansion — adding new drives, new I/O nodes, or new SCADA clients — is straightforward within the existing Profibus-DP or USS network topology.

Industrial Connectivity FAQ

Q1: What is the communication latency of the 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 on a Profibus-DP network?
Profibus-DP cyclic communication latency for the 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 is typically in the range of 1–10 ms depending on network baud rate (up to 12 Mbps) and the number of slaves on the bus. At 1.5 Mbps with a standard 32-slave network, cycle times of 2–5 ms are typical, making it suitable for real-time closed-loop control applications.

Q2: Is the 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 compatible with third-party PLCs and SCADA systems?
Yes. The Profibus-DP interface follows the IEC 61158 standard, making the 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 compatible with any Profibus-DP master — including Siemens S7, Schneider Electric Modicon, ABB AC500, and Rockwell ControlLogix with Profibus scanner cards. The USS protocol interface is similarly open and documented, supporting integration with any RS-485 master capable of implementing the USS specification.

Q3: How does the drive maintain network stability in electrically noisy industrial environments?
The 6SE6440-2UD24-0BA1 incorporates EMC-compliant shielding and filtering on its communication interfaces. Profibus-DP cabling should use shielded twisted-pair (STP) cable per EN 50170, with proper grounding at both ends. The drive’s internal EMC filter (Class A) reduces conducted emissions, and the Profibus interface includes optical isolation to prevent ground loop interference from corrupting network data.
